Macomb County
Macomb County has roughly average household income, with a median household income of $77,837. Population has held roughly steady since 2000. Median home value has more than doubled since 2000, reaching $243,900. It sits in the top 10% of US counties for household income.

How many people live in Macomb County, Michigan?
Macomb County, Michigan has about 879,853 residents according to the 2024 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in Macomb County, Michigan?
The typical household in Macomb County, Michigan earns about $77,837 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Macomb County, Michigan expensive?
In Macomb County, Michigan, the median home is worth about $243,900, and the typical rent is about $1,211 a month.
How educated are people in Macomb County, Michigan?
About 27.7% of adults age 25 and over in Macomb County, Michigan h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Macomb County, Michigan?
About 10.4% of people in Macomb County, Michigan live below the federal poverty line.
Has Macomb County, Michigan grown since 1990?
Yes, Macomb County, Michigan has grown since 1990. The population has added about 162,453 residents, a change of about 23 percent over that period.
